Silver Oak Park
Silver Oak Park is a park in Isanti, Minnesota. Silver Oak Park is situated nearby to Honeysuckle Park, as well as near the nature reserve Joe’s Lake Natural Preserve.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Cambridge and Grandy.
Cambridge
Town

Cambridge is a city in Isanti County, Minnesota, United States, located at the junction of Minnesota State Highways 65 and 95. The population was 9,611 at the 2020 census.
Grandy
Village
Grandy is an unincorporated community in Cambridge Township, Isanti County, Minnesota, United States. Grandy is located north of the city of Cambridge at the junction of State Highway 65 and Isanti County Road 6. Stanchfield and Braham are nearby. Grandy is situated 5 miles north of Silver Oak Park.
Isanti
Village

Isanti is a city in Isanti County, Minnesota, United States. The population was 6,804 at the 2020 census. The name Isanti is composed of two Dakota words: isan and ati, and refers to the Santee Dakota people. Isanti is situated 5 miles south of Silver Oak Park.
